WebJun 3, 2024 · Grill the pork chops one more minute for every 10 degrees the pork chop is under the optimal temperature. So, for example, if the temp of your pork chops reads 120 F when you take it off the grill, put them back … WebCook for 8-12 minutes over direct heat, flipping every 3-4 minutes, or until fully grill marked, with the lid closed, for 1-inch thick boneless pork chops. Allow for a further 5 minutes of …

WebJul 6, 2024 · Add the pork chops, close the lid (for a gas grill) and cook 5-6 minutes. Flip, close the lid (for a gas grill) and cook to an internal temperature of 145°F, another 5-6 minutes. Let rest for 5 minutes before serving.
